Fall City-Wide Clean Up dates announced

Citywide clean up

As the weather hopefully begins to cool and we enter the fall season, the City will once again offer options for safely and responsibly disposing of unwanted items. 

BRUSH DROP OFF — The fall City-Wide Brush Drop Off will be held from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. on September 22nd and 23rd. To access the drop off site, residents should drive to City Park at Bradley Avenue and Ash Street and follow event signs. Crews will be available to help unload trailers. Crews ask that all limbs be less than 10 inches in diameter and want to remind residents that no yard waste will be accepted. 

The event is only for those living inside City limits. Contractors will not be allowed to use the service. Mulch and compost will NOT be available. 

TRASH ITEMS — This year’s fall City-Wide Clean Up will be held on September 16. The City once again will be using the GFL/WCA facility, located at 22820 MO-291 Highway, as the host for the event. Gates will be open from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. 

Residents will unload their own vehicles, with the assistance of City staff. This event is only available for those who live within the City limits. To participate, residents will need to provide proof of residency within the City limits of Harrisonville. 

GFL would also like to remind residents that they will pick up one bulky item per month, for FREE.  To get your free item picked up, contact GFL's Customer Service Department (816) 380-5595 or email kccustomercare@gflenv.com
